Gregor Laudage is a Ph.D. student and a law clerk at the Higher Regional Court of Hamburg.
After studying at the University of Goettingen, Gregor passed the first state examination in Lower Saxony, which is equivalent to a Master’s degree. His doctoral thesis focuses on whether and how the Eurosystem could conduct a green monetary policy under the current legal framework. After graduating, Gregor worked as a research assistant at the University of Goettingen and the University of Bremen as well as at an international law firm in Hamburg. Besides his PhD thesis, he is interested in off-balance-sheet fiscal agencies. In an ongoing research project, he co-developed a framework for assessing Germany’s fiscal ecosystem from a legal and political economy perspective.
